I need some help
A customer of mine just had her lawn aerated and over seeded , I was wondering should I use my 36 or use my 21 just because the grass is still very new ? It has been about 10 days after aeration and overseeding

It would be better to use your push mower if you can but if your 36 doesn't usually have a problem with tearing up your yard you should be fine. It also matters if there is a lot of grass in the area or if it is pretty bare with new grass coming through. I usually mow with new grass coming up with my 61 turf tiger because i have to get the leaves up.
